Output c3a95c45a60619e336ad40b2b7ebc854119e105fd3c747ea04738cf7b1c6ab30:7

value
3950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 381b76233dc3a24feb499136c7a723c3ac1369a2 OP_EQUAL
address
36ogfLr8Wxsj3qN5aWqgJupJq7dBnAA4cN
transaction
c3a95c45a60619e336ad40b2b7ebc854119e105fd3c747ea04738cf7b1c6ab30
confirmations
361883
spent
true